Tank Mixer Design & Performance Optimization

Designing and optimizing tank mixers involves a meticulous understanding of fluid dynamics, mixing efficiency, and the specific needs of the application. Key considerations include tank geometry, impeller type, motor power, and speed. Careful selection and arrangement of these components are crucial for achieving optimal agitation performance.

Various design tools can be employed to predict mixer performance and adjust parameters for desired results. Laboratory trials are also essential to validate the design and ensure that it meets the required mixing effectiveness.

  • Performance indicators often include mixing time, uniformity of distribution, power consumption, and noise levels.
  • Enhancement efforts may involve exploring innovative control strategies to further boost performance and minimize energy usage.
